Abstract

<P>PROBLEM TO BE SOLVED: To keep a similarly good appearance in both cases of use that a thumbtack having a magnet is fixed by a needle and is fixed by the magnet. <P>SOLUTION: This thumbtack has the magnet 2 on the bottom surface side of a base plate, and a through hole is penetrated in the thickness direction of the base plate. The upper surface side of the base plate is covered by an elastic cover which expands into a dome-shape, a thumbtack fixing piece provided above the through hole of the base plate is made to go along the internal side of the cover by the elasticity. The head section of the thumbtack is placed in a gap between the cover and the thumbtack fixing piece, and the needle section of the thumbtack is inserted in the through hole of the base plate through the thumbtack fixing piece. When the covers is depressed to an article to be fixed to which the magnet does not stick, the cover and the thumbtack fixing piece are deformed, and the needle section protrudes from the through hole of the base plate, and stuck into the article. When the depressing of the cover is released, the cover expands into the dome shape by the elastic force while the thumbtack fixing piece is being deformed. When the needle section of the thumbtack is removed from the article to be fixed, the thumbtack fixing piece is returned to the state going along the dome-like cover by the elastic force. The cover edge section is fixed to the outer peripheral surface of the base plate, and a flange for a knob is projected on the upper section of the outer peripheral surface of the base plate under a state going through the cover. <P>COPYRIGHT: (C)2006,JPO&NCIPI

本発明の画鋲は図1及び図2に示すように、円盤状の基板1と、基板1の底面側に接着等で固定する磁石2と、基板1の上面をドーム状に膨らむ状態で覆うカバー3と、カバー3の内側に沿う鋲止め片4と、カバー3と鋲止め片4の間の隙間Gに頭部5を収容する鋲6とから構成される。そして基板1の中央部に抜穴7を厚み方向に貫通して設け、鋲6の針部8を鋲止め片4を貫通して基板1の抜穴7に挿入し、ドーム状に膨らむカバー3の弾性とカバー3の内側に沿う鋲止め片4の弾性によって、カバー3と鋲止め片4の間を開閉可能に設けると共に、鋲6の針部8を基板1の抜穴7から出し入れ可能に設けたものである。   As shown in FIGS. 1 and 2, the thumbtack of the present invention is a cover that covers a disk-shaped substrate 1, a magnet 2 that is fixed to the bottom surface side of the substrate 1 by adhesion or the like, and a top surface of the substrate 1 that swells in a dome shape. 3, a tacking piece 4 along the inside of the cover 3, and a brim 6 that accommodates the head 5 in the gap G between the cover 3 and the tacking piece 4. Then, a through hole 7 is provided in the center portion of the substrate 1 in the thickness direction, and the needle portion 8 of the flange 6 is inserted into the extraction hole 7 of the substrate 1 through the anchoring piece 4, and the cover 3 swells in a dome shape. And the elasticity of the tacking piece 4 along the inside of the cover 3 are provided so that the cover 3 and the tacking piece 4 can be opened and closed, and the needle portion 8 of the collar 6 can be taken in and out of the hole 7 of the substrate 1. It is provided.

基板1はプラスチック製の円盤であって、その底面の外周部にリング状の窪み9を形成し、その窪み9にリング状の磁石2を接着等して貼り付ける。また、基板1はその中央部には、前述したように抜穴7をあけ、その上面には抜穴7よりも大径の凹部10を、抜穴7と同心円状に形成し、カバー3を押し込んだ際に鋲6の頭部5及び鋲止め片4の一部(頭部5の周辺部分)を凹部10に収容する。また、基板1は、その外周面の上部に複数のつまみ用の鍔11を、周方向に沿って間隔をあけて設けてある。   The substrate 1 is a plastic disk, and a ring-shaped recess 9 is formed on the outer peripheral portion of the bottom surface thereof, and a ring-shaped magnet 2 is adhered and bonded to the recess 9. Further, the substrate 1 has a hole 7 formed in the central portion thereof as described above, and a concave portion 10 having a diameter larger than that of the hole 7 is formed on the upper surface thereof so as to be concentric with the hole 7. When pushed, the head 5 of the heel 6 and a part of the heel stopper piece 4 (the peripheral portion of the head 5) are accommodated in the recess 10. In addition, the substrate 1 is provided with a plurality of knobs 11 on the upper surface of the outer peripheral surface at intervals along the circumferential direction.

カバー3は、基板1の上面をドーム状に膨らむ状態で覆うと共にその縁部を基板1と磁石2の外周面に貼り付けるもので、縁部には鍔11を通す貫通穴12をあけてある。また、カバー3は、ドーム状に膨らむ弾性素材(例えば、ビニル樹脂)を用いるもので、基板1の上面を覆う部分の内側に帯状の鋲止め片4を、基板1の抜穴7の上方を覆う部分から放射状に延長すると共に、鋲止め片4の両端部をカバー3に連続することによって、カバー3と鋲止め片4を開閉可能な二重構造としてある。カバー3と鋲止め片4を製作する一例としては、樹脂シートを鋲止め片4の厚み分だけ厚くして全体で例えば1mmに一体成形し、厚みを薄くする方向に切り込みを入れることによって、鋲止め片4を両端部以外ではカバー3と分離する。そして、基板1にカバー3を固定する場合は、カバー3と鋲止め片4の間を広げてから、鋲6の針部8を鋲止め片4の中央部に突き刺し、カバー3と鋲止め片4の隙間Gに鋲6の頭部5を収容し、針部8を基板の抜穴7に通しながら、カバー3の縁部を基板1と磁石2の外周面に跨って貼り付ける。   The cover 3 covers the upper surface of the substrate 1 so as to swell in a dome shape, and its edge is attached to the outer peripheral surface of the substrate 1 and the magnet 2. A through-hole 12 through which the flange 11 is passed is formed in the edge. . Further, the cover 3 uses an elastic material (for example, vinyl resin) that swells in a dome shape, and a band-shaped tacking piece 4 is provided inside a portion covering the upper surface of the substrate 1, and the upper side of the hole 7 of the substrate 1. The cover 3 and the tacking piece 4 have a double structure that can be opened and closed by extending radially from the covering portion and continuing both ends of the tacking piece 4 to the cover 3. As an example of manufacturing the cover 3 and the tacking piece 4, the resin sheet is thickened by the thickness of the tacking piece 4, integrally formed to, for example, 1 mm as a whole, and cut in a direction to reduce the thickness. The stopper piece 4 is separated from the cover 3 except at both ends. And when fixing the cover 3 to the board | substrate 1, after extending the space | interval between the cover 3 and the tacking piece 4, the needle part 8 of the collar 6 is stabbed into the center part of the tacking piece 4, and the cover 3 and the tacking piece The head 5 of the heel 6 is accommodated in the gap G of 4, and the edge of the cover 3 is pasted across the outer peripheral surface of the substrate 1 and the magnet 2 while passing the needle portion 8 through the hole 7 of the substrate.

上述した本発明の画鋲は以下の要領で使用する。図1(イ)に示すように、鉄などの被固定物13に対して留める場合は、基板1の底面側を被固定物13に当て磁石2の力を利用して被固定物13に留める。また、図1(ロ)に示すように、被固定物13が磁石2で貼り付かないもの、例えば木材などである場合には、基板1の底面側を被固定物13に当てたままカバー3を指で押し込むと、カバー3及び鋲止め片4が変形して基板1の上面に押し当たって、基板1の抜穴7から鋲6の針部8が突出して被固定物13に突き刺さる。図1(ハ)に示すように指を離すと、鋲止め片4は基板1に沿って変形した状態であるにも関わらず、カバー3は復元力によってドーム状に膨らむ形態となる。また、画鋲を外す際には、鍔11と被固定物13との間には、指先を入れることのできるギャップがあいているので、そのギャップを利用して鍔11をつまんで被固定物13に対して引っ張ればよい。針部8が被固定物13から抜けると、図1(イ)に示すように鋲止め片4はその復元力によって、カバー3の内側に沿う状態となり、針部8が基板の抜穴7に収容される。   The thumbtack of the present invention described above is used in the following manner. As shown in FIG. 1 (a), in the case of fastening to an object 13 such as iron, the bottom surface side of the substrate 1 is applied to the object 13 and the force of the magnet 2 is used to fasten it to the object 13. . Further, as shown in FIG. 1B, when the fixed object 13 is not attached by the magnet 2, for example, wood, the cover 3 with the bottom surface side of the substrate 1 placed on the fixed object 13. Is pushed with the finger, the cover 3 and the hook stopper 4 are deformed and pressed against the upper surface of the substrate 1, and the needle portion 8 of the flange 6 protrudes from the hole 7 of the substrate 1 and pierces the fixed object 13. When the finger is released as shown in FIG. 1 (c), the cover 3 swells in a dome shape due to the restoring force even though the tacking piece 4 is deformed along the substrate 1. Further, when removing the thumbtack, there is a gap in which a fingertip can be inserted between the heel 11 and the object 13 to be fixed. Just pull it against. When the needle portion 8 comes out of the object 13 to be fixed, as shown in FIG. 1 (a), the tacking piece 4 is brought into a state along the inner side of the cover 3 by the restoring force, and the needle portion 8 enters the hole 7 of the substrate. Be contained.
